Output ef2cf5323cac25b587f5586cdb4f71fbd1a52f436dfeec756ba4a8d5f30f6560:3

value
310130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10a29c8b4e403cbf83806227a73ac29df3d93d77 OP_EQUAL
address
33CyY4KyDyVGM14uqEM9HCQG6gb6QYbUkL
transaction
ef2cf5323cac25b587f5586cdb4f71fbd1a52f436dfeec756ba4a8d5f30f6560
spent
true